1 person killed after residential apartment wall collapses in Ruaka

NAIROBI, Kenya, Apr 22 – One person has been killed after a perimeter wall at an apartment building collapsed in Ruaka during heavy rains.

According to Kiambu Governor Kimani Wamatangi, two other people were injured following the incident.

He stated that a third person was rescued during the operation by the county government’s disaster management team.

The County Government has subsequently ordered tenants living in the surrounding three apartments to vacate as a precautionary measure.

Governor Wamatangi stated that a multi-agency team comprising county and national government officials will embark on conducting an inspection and assessment exercise of all structures in the county.
